In today's digital age, having a strong online presence is essential for any business, including electricians. One effective way to boost your online visibility and attract more customers is by creating explainer videos. These short, engaging videos can help educate potential clients about your services and showcase your expertise in the field. But how can you ensure that your explainer videos are optimized for search engines? In this blog post, we'll discuss some best practices for creating electrician content that is not only informative and engaging but also SEO-friendly. 1. Focus on relevant keywords: Before creating your explainer video, do some research to identify the keywords that potential customers are using to search for electrician services. Incorporate these keywords naturally into your video script and title to improve your chances of ranking high in search engine results. 2. Keep it concise and to the point: When creating an explainer video, it's important to keep it short and sweet. Aim for a video length of around 1-2 minutes to hold viewers' attention and deliver your message effectively. Remember to include a clear call-to-action at the end of the video to encourage viewers to take the next step, such as contacting you for a consultation. 3. Optimize your video for mobile viewing: With more and more people using smartphones and tablets to browse the internet, it's crucial to ensure that your explainer video is optimized for mobile viewing. Make sure your video is responsive and loads quickly on mobile devices to provide a seamless viewing experience for all users. 4. Utilize video descriptions and tags: When uploading your explainer video to platforms like YouTube or Vimeo, take advantage of the description and tag sections to provide additional information about your services and improve your video's visibility. Include relevant keywords in your video description and tags to help search engines understand the content of your video. 5. Promote your video on social media: Once you've created your explainer video, don't forget to promote it on social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n. Sharing your video with your followers can help increase its reach and drive more traffic to your website. By following these best practices for creating SEO-friendly explainer videos, you can enhance your online presence as an electrician and attract more customers to your business. Remember to continually monitor your video's performance and make adjustments as needed to ensure that your content remains relevant and engaging to your target audience.
